Duties and Responsibilities:
-
Helps support Commercial Loan Officers in the management of existing commercial credit relationships and partners with the Commercial Loan Officers in support of new relationships.
-
Serves as the primary point of contact for existing borrowing relationships.
-
Manages relationships with existing borrowers and supports Commercial Loan Officers with managing new relationships.
-
Partners directly with the commercial lending team to ensure timely annual reviews, document performance against covenants and conditions, and assists CLO in monitoring and developing action plans for deteriorating credit relationships (i.e., watchlist reports, problem loan status reports, etc.).
-
Collects updated information, analyzes data, and creates periodic loan review memorandums with risk upgrade or downgrade recommendations with assistance from the CLO, as needed.
-
Creates, coordinates, and reviews annual review memorandums, property inspections, and commercial real estate evaluations for accuracy and further approval recommendations.
-
Underwrites, structures, and helps document new loans or modifications to existing client relationship.
-
Seeks cross-sell opportunities and directs members to other services and products offered by the credit union to meet the needs of the business relationship.
-
Performs all due diligence required including the review of financial, entity, legal and other documents prior to credit submission to protect credit union resources.
-
Supports the CLO in the management of the assigned portfolio by monitoring performance and trends, proactively defining credit relationship solutions, identifying issues and developing remediation, underwriting and providing credit approval recommendations as designated.
-
Supports the CLO in developing and maintaining special reports as needed for commercial lending team to monitor risk, realize opportunities, and aid in department and portfolio allocation and management.
-
Assists in ensuring the department adheres to all state/federal regulations, policies, and procedural guidelines. Provides feedback to commercial lending policy and procedural updates and revisions, as required. Remains current on industry, market trends and changes to regulation.
-
All other duties as assigned.
